Hill.sd: Hill.sd

Description

Returns the estimated asymptotic standard deviation for the Z estimator of Hill's diversity numbe. Note that this is also the asymptotic standard deviation of the plug-in estimator. See Zhang and Grabchak (2014a) for details.

Usage

Hill.sd(x, r)

Arguments

x

Vector of counts. Must be integer valued. Each entry represents the number of observations of a distinct letter.

r

Order of Hill's deversity numbe. Must be a strictly positive real number.
